Passenger Rail Investment and Improvement Act of 2008

To reauthorize Amtrak, and for other purposes.

Other Bill Titles (4 more)

6/11/2008--Passed House amended. Passenger Rail Investment and Improvement Act of 2008 - Title I: Authorizations -
(Sec. 101) Authorizes appropriations for FY2009-FY2013 for:

Latest Vote

June 11, 2008Roll call number 400 in the House
Question: On Passage: H R 6003 Passenger Rail Investment and Improvement Act
Required percentage of 'Aye' votes: 1/2 (50%) Percentage of 'aye' votes: 71% Result: Passed
